Christina Aguilera Does Incredible Britney Spears Impression on The Tonight Show With Jimmy Fallon: Watch

Imitation just may be the highest form of flattery for Christina Aguilera and Britney Spears. The Voice coach, 34, stopped by The Tonight Show on Monday, Feb. 23, and did her best Britney — which turned out to be very, very good — for host Jimmy Fallon.

Fallon, 40, inspired the performance with a round of his Wheel of Musical Impressions game. Though Aguilera appeared hesitant at first, she quickly got on board.

“How it works is we’re gonna take turns hitting this button here, which activates the musical impressions generator,” the funnyman explained. “It will land on one random singer that one of us can do an impression of and then one random song title… Whoever’s turn it is has to do an impression of that musician doing that song.”

The “Say Something” chart-topper started things off and was tasked with performing the Folgers Coffee jingle as famed belter Cher. “Let me get my Cher on,” Aguilera said, before giving a rendition that would make the “Believe” singer proud.

Fallon took his turn, singing “You’re a Grand Old Flag” as David Bowie, before Aguilera was back on the button again.

She landed on Britney Spears, exclaiming “Britney!” as her former pop rival’s name came up. “Britney Spears? You know Britney Spears, right?” Fallon questioned. “Lil’ bit,” Aguilera responded with a smile. “Lil’ bit.”

The Grammy winner then did an epic impersonation of her former Mickey Mouse Club costar turned teen pop star, singing “This Little Piggy” to the tune of Spears’ debut star-making single “…Baby One More Time.”
